Transaction 40faeba2db711c0344f28ace6c9e986d2e58ea5d1a84331734d7fb901abfaf30

1 Input
1 Outputs
  • 40faeba2db711c0344f28ace6c9e986d2e58ea5d1a84331734d7fb901abfaf30:0
  • value  1127632
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G